About agriculture in Loon

Located on the western coast of Bohol island in the Central Visayas, Loon is characterized by its rolling hills and proximity to the sea. The rural landscape features a mix of coastal plains and elevated limestone terrain, offering a scenic backdrop for agricultural activities. The area is known for its natural springs and diverse maritime environment that influences the local climate.

The agricultural sector in Loon focuses on coconut plantations and rice cultivation in the flatter areas. Farmers also grow corn and various root crops like ubi, which is a staple in the region. Small-scale livestock farming, particularly poultry and swine, is common among local households, contributing to the community's food security and local markets.
